The Emmys Arrived, Because Apparently TV Needed a Group Project

This week’s celebrity-news machine got a very shiny distraction: the 2026 Emmy nominations. As usual, the announcement created a glorious little storm of celebration, confusion, fan debates, and people dramatically asking, “How was that not nominated?” The Primetime Emmy Awards are scheduled for September 14, 2026, with Mariska Hargitay set to host, which already gives the ceremony a strong “classy but capable of side-eye” energy.


Major contenders include shows like The Pitt, Hacks, Abbott Elementary, The Bear, Only Murders in the Building, The Diplomat, The Gilded Age, and more, meaning the awards race is officially crowded, dramatic, and probably already ruining group chats everywhere.


Taylor Swift Turned Her Eras Tour Into an Emmy Moment, Naturally

Taylor Swift had another very normal, quiet week — which, in Swift terms, means five Emmy nominations. Her Disney+ concert special Taylor Swift | The Eras Tour | The Final Show earned nominations including Outstanding Variety Special, along with recognition in directing, editing, sound mixing, and technical direction/camerawork.


The special captures the final Eras Tour performance in Vancouver and continues the awards-life of a tour that already made history as the first concert tour to gross more than $2 billion worldwide. The Emmy Snubs and Surprises Gave Everyone Something to Argue About

Of course, no nominations announcement is complete without a dramatic buffet of snubs and surprises. Entertainment Weekly noted that The Pitt led with 25 nominations, while Hacks followed with 24, setting up a serious awards-season showdown.


Reality TV also got a shake-up, with Dancing With the Stars returning to the reality competition category after a long absence, while The Amazing Race was surprisingly left out.
